Understanding Credits in Caplena

Understand how Caplena Credits work, what they’re used for, how they’re consumed, and how to manage them efficiently within your projects.

Credits are Caplena’s internal currency. You use them to pay for AI-powered analyses and features within the platform.

How Credits Are Used

All compute-heavy, AI-powered actions consume credits. The main actions are:

 

Analyzing Open-Ends
Each text entry (i.e., one cell in your uploaded file) costs 1 credit per selected text-to-analyze (TTA) column.

  • Only columns you select for analysis are charged.

  • Additional columns (e.g., numerical data, demographics, segments) are free.

  • Empty cells or cells containing defined dummy values are not charged.

Examples:


    • 1 TTA column × 4 rows = 4 credits

    • 2 TTA columns × 4 rows = 8 credits


 

Re-running Analyses (New or Updated Topic Assignments)
Each project includes some free full AI topic re-assignments depending on your plan.

  • You can also perform partial reassignments (e.g., updating single topics), these are counted proportionally toward the free limit.

  • Purchasing additional full updates is usually only required if you want to perform a completely new analysis.

  • Beyond the free quota, additional full runs cost 50% of the original import cost.

Example:
If your initial import cost 1,000 credits, each additional full re-run costs 500 credits.



 

LLM Smart Columns
Using LLM-powered Smart Columns (e.g., for summarization or transformation) costs 0.25 credits per computed row.


 

What If I Make a Mistake?

No worries,we’ve got you covered!

  • Every account comes with built-in demo projects, which do not consume any credits.

  • For accidental uploads or honest mistakes, we're happy to reimburse credits, at least partially (translation fees may be excluded since they’re paid directly to third parties).

  • For testing, we recommend uploading small sample datasets first.

 


 

Using Dummy Variables

If your dataset contains placeholders like -99, n/a, or 0 to represent empty responses:

  • You can define up to three dummy values in your account settings

  • These will be ignored in future uploads (just like empty cells)

This helps avoid being charged for rows that don’t contain real content.
